    Like its neighbors, the Chellberg barn is located north of the main house. It was built between 1870 and 1879, using a design common for that time. [5] The 1880 census showed the Chellbergs having 'two milk cows, six other cattle, two sheep and five horses.' Over the years, the use of the barn changed and so did its design.

    It is known as the Brown Swiss Dairy barn. A gravel drive extends to the barn, passing the 1911 concrete farmhouse. The polygonal barn consists of the original 1908 twelve-sided barn, a 1911 attached silo, a c.1920 rectangular addition, and a 1960s one story addition. Next to the barn is a free standing c.1950 milk house. [2]

    The Haimbaugh barn is quite unusual and unique among Indiana examples. Being one of the 77 remaining true circular barns of the 151 that were built (219 round and polygonal barns were built in Indiana). The barn is unique with the 20-foot (6.1 m)-deep shed that wraps halfway around the barn.

    Maria and Franklin Wiltrout Polygonal Barn, also known as the Alfred Barn, is a historic 14-sided barn located in Fairfield Township, DeKalb County, Indiana.     The three round barns in the historic district were inspired by the work of Benton Steele, Samuel Francis ("Frank") Detraz, Isaac and Emery McNamee, and Horace Duncan, who, in various combinations, had built at least 8 round barns in Indiana by mid-1902.
